Output 3176072a65f813b86af402654aae1ff82c526720e90941d02a92ce8622aa0952:1

value
15572901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dd7236d798fcb9cb345e1a5bac3579cecbc347c OP_EQUAL
address
3QqCc9twq5Yj6RgxbXitp8fyUZEEYje5bP
transaction
3176072a65f813b86af402654aae1ff82c526720e90941d02a92ce8622aa0952
spent
true